Article: Crede two-times Jays After home run ties game in ninth inning, rookie's first grand slam wins it in 10th

White Sox 8

Blue Jays 4

Joe Crede saved the day Tuesday, just a little too late to help staff ace Mark Buehrle.

Crede gave the White Sox an 8-4 victory with a grand slam against the Toronto Blue Jays' Felix Heredia in the 10th inning, one inning after sending it into extra innings with a two-run home run in the ninth.

It was the kind of coming-out party the Sox were looking for from their rookie third baseman, but the soft-spoken Crede was taking his seven-RBI night in stride.
